技术文摘
从零开始学 Java 之 While 循环
从零开始学 Java 之 While 循环
在 Java 编程中,循环结构是非常重要的一部分,它能够帮助我们重复执行一段代码,以实现各种复杂的功能。而 While 循环就是其中一种常见的循环结构。
While 循环的基本语法是:
while (条件表达式) {
// 循环体
}
当条件表达式的结果为 true 时,循环体中的代码就会被执行。执行完一次循环体后,会再次判断条件表达式,如果依然为 true ,则继续执行循环体,直到条件表达式的结果为 false ,循环才会结束。
下面通过一个简单的示例来理解 While 循环的使用。假设我们要打印出从 1 到 10 的数字:
int i = 1;
while (i <= 10) {
System.out.println(i);
i++;
}
在上述代码中,首先定义了一个变量 i 并初始化为 1 。然后,在 While 循环中,只要 i 小于等于 10 ,就会执行循环体。循环体中先打印出当前的 i 值,然后将 i 的值增加 1 。当 i 的值超过 10 时,循环结束。
需要注意的是,如果条件表达式一开始就是 false ,那么循环体中的代码一次都不会执行。
另外,在使用 While 循环时,一定要确保循环能够在合适的时候结束,否则可能会导致死循环的出现,使程序陷入无限循环的状态,从而消耗大量的系统资源。
例如,如果在上述示例中忘记了 i++ 这一步,那么 i 的值永远不会超过 10 ,循环就会一直进行下去,造成死循环。
While 循环在很多场景中都非常有用。比如,当我们不知道循环需要执行的具体次数,但能通过某个条件来控制循环的结束时,While 循环就能够发挥出它的优势。
掌握好 While 循环对于学习 Java 编程至关重要。通过不断地练习和实践,我们能够更加熟练地运用 While 循环来解决各种实际问题,为进一步深入学习 Java 打下坚实的基础。
TAGS: Java 基础 Java 学习指南 While 循环用法 循环编程技巧
- MySQL连接异常终止后的数据恢复与修复方法
- 在命令行中测试MySQL连接写入性能的方法
- MySQL连接错误1018该如何处理
- Python程序中如何优化MySQL连接的备份与恢复性能
- MySQL连接错误1210如何处理
- MySQL连接异常终止时数据镜像的处理方法
- MySQL连接超时时间该如何设置
- MySQL连接被重置,怎样利用连接复用来提升连接池利用率
- MySQL连接错误1115该如何处理
- 命令行中怎样测试MySQL连接的存储性能
- MySQL连接错误1317该如何处理
- Python程序中实现MySQL连接自动重试的方法
- MySQL连接错误1052该如何处理
- 如何排查MySQL连接问题
- MySQL连接重置后怎样自动恢复连接池状态